Press statement by MCA Youth Spokesperson Alex Fong Kah Wei


Price cap on COVID-19 testing kits will benefit all Malaysians as lockdowns ease


 

The government’s initiative to implement a price cap for COVID-19 self-test kits is not just a pro-Rakyat scheme, but the increased affordability also encourages the practice of self-testing as the economy gradually reopens.

 

Furthermore, Health Minister Khairy Jamaluddin has on several occasions expressed that Malaysians will inevitably have to live alongside the COVID-19 virus for some time as the virus becomes endemic. Hence, self-test kits are likely to become just as essential as hand sanitisers and facemasks during this period.

 

When Malaysians start returning to work at their respective workplaces, periodical self-testing will become an essential practice to ensure infection is detected early and the risk of infecting others as low as possible. The practice of self-testing will become a shared responsibility of the whole community.

 

As manufacturers speed up production and increase supply of the test kits, we hope that the prices can be further lowered beyond the current price cap of RM19.90 retail and RM16 wholesale. This is to ensure that everyone can purchase the test kits without incurring too much of a financial burden.

 

With a disciplined approach to self-testing and strict SOP observance, Malaysians can surely overcome the COVID-19 pandemic, rebuild Malaysia, and be reunited with loved ones again.
